Morocco, Russia poised to sign technical cooperation accord on fisheries
Morocco-Russia, Economics, 2/1/2002
Russia and Morocco are about to finalize a protocol of agreement on technical cooperation in matters of fisheries, that is to be signed shortly, reported Thursday Russian business daily Kommersant.
The daily said the two sides finally decided to promote their technical cooperation, two years after the bilateral fishery agreement expired in 1999. Since that date, the daily recalled, Morocco refused to extend the said accord despite the repeated requests made by Russia, as Russian trawlers wish to operate off the Atlantic.
The daily pointed out that Morocco, which justified its firm stand by the depletion of its sea resources, mainly sardines, is about to adopt a new fishery development strategy, that will define, inter alia, the legal conditions to be fulfilled by maritime companies to be authorized to fish in Moroccan grounds.
Quoting Russian sources, the daily said the two sides might have agreed, during the visit Moroccan foreign minister paid to Russia earlier this week, to sign the protocol of agreement shortly.
